Bad Rothenfelde, Lower Saxony, Germany

Overview

Bad Rothenfelde is a picturesque spa town set amidst the green landscapes of Lower Saxony, known for its historic saltworks and healing thermal baths. With fewer than 9,000 residents, it offers a tranquil atmosphere, excellent wellness facilities, and scenic parks. The town seamlessly blends tradition and nature, making it an ideal getaway for relaxation seekers.

Best Time to Visit

April-June and September-October for mild weather and fewer crowds.

Local Tips

Bring comfortable walking shoes and explore the town's network of trails. Many restaurants close early, so plan your meals ahead. Public transport is reliable but infrequent, so check schedules.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ping 5-10% is customary; casual but tidy dress is recommended in restaurants; respect spa etiquette such as quiet zones and towel use.

Safety Warnings

The town is very safe; standard precautions suffice. Watch for occasional slippery pavements near saltworks during rainy weather.

Hidden Gems

Stroll the lesser-known woodland paths in Salinenpark, visit the Rothenfelder Mühle historic mill, and stop by local family-run bakeries for regional treats.
